Electric Dryer Rating:

240V

5600W

24A

60Hz

208V

4400W

22A

60Hz

Exhaust Option: 4-way rear, right, left and bottom
Circuit Requirements: An individual, properly-grounded branch circuit, protected by

a 30-amp circuit breaker or a time-delay fuse, is required.
Note: Dryer wall outlet must be located within 36" of service cord entry and

acessible when dryer is mounted in position.
Installation Information: For complete information, see installation instructions

packed with your dryer.

Special Installation Requirements
Alcove or Closet Installation:

• If your dryer is approved for installation in an alcove or closet, it will be stated on a label

on the dryer back.

• The dryer MUST be exhausted to the outside.

• Minimum clearances between dryer cabinet and adjacent walls or other surfaces are:

0" either side; 3" front and rear

• Minimum vertical space from floor to overhead cabinets, ceilings, etc. is 52”.

• Closet doors must be louvered or otherwise ventilated and must contain a minimum

of 60 sq. in. of open area equally distributed. If this closet contains both a washer and

a dryer, doors must contain a minimum of 120 sq. in. of open area equally distributed.

• No other fuel-burning appliance shall be installed in the same closet with a gas dryer.
Bathroom or Bedroom Installation:

• The dryer MUST be exhausted to the outdoors.

• The installation must conform with the local codes, or in the absence of local codes,

with the National Electric Code and National Fuel Gas Code, ANSI Z223 for gas dryers.

Minimum Clearances other than Alcove or Closet Installation:

• Minimum clearances to combustible surfaces are: 0" both sides; 3" rear
Dryer Exhausting Information : Use metal duct only, vertical and horizontal ducting.
